Liberia: Defendant Admits Stabbing Journalist Tyron Brown Three Times


Defendant Williams told the court he and the Tyron Brown engaged in a fist-fight, got overpowered and decided to stab him to scare him away. Photo credit: Peter Nimley TobyTUBMANBURG, Bomi County – The man who allegedly killed Journalist Tyron Brown has defended his action against the journalist saying he was attacked by the journalist on the night of incidence at his Duport Road resident. Defendant Jonathan Williams is facing criminal prosecution at the 11th Judicial Circuit Court in Tubmanburg, Bomi County for allegedly killing Tyron Brown at his Duport Road residence on April 15, 2018. He said journalist Brown was standing near the well in the compound which prompted him (Williams) to inquire who was in the compound. According to him, Brown in response rather rained insults at him which resorted to a fistfight between them.
